主流AI框架,总有一款适合你
1、推荐:modelArts、PAI、Paddle等解决方案,从宏观层面了解AI。AI从业者但不追求模型部署:目的:了解领域主流模型的构建和训练方法。推荐:PyTorch、TensorFlow keras。AI从业者且追求模型在生产环境落地:目的:夯实工程经验,达成商业目标。推荐:TensorFlow。
2、TensorFlow是人工智能领域最常用的框架,是一个使用数据流图进行数值计算的开源软件,该框架允许在任何CPU或GPU上进行计算,无论是台式机、服务器还是移动设备都支持。该框架使用c++和python作为编程语言,简单易学。
3、选择安装哪款AI软件,主要取决于你的需求和偏好。以下是一些热门的AI软件供你选择:TensorFlow:这是一个强大的开源软件库,常用于深度学习和其他机器学习应用。如果你对深度学习和神经网络有浓厚兴趣,TensorFlow是个不错的选择。PyTorch:与TensorFlow相似,也是一个流行的深度学习框架。
4、Vega 设计平台这是一个AI驱动的设计工具平台。主要特点:提供文生图、图生图等设计功能。允许用户上传自己的设计进行AI训练,产生与用户风格相似的设计。 D-Human 数字人这是一个数字人生成平台,被认为有高性价比。它的亮点:可以快速制作数字人口播视频。提供开放接口,支持更多的应用场景。
5、在国产AI助手领域,豆包、智谱、kimi和元宝各有千秋,每款产品都以其独特的功能和优势吸引着不同需求的用户。以下是对这四款AI助手的全面对比,帮助你找到最适合自己的那一款。产品特点 豆包:豆包在办公和生活帮手等场景之间寻找到了完美的平衡。它功能全面,产品设计优秀,使用起来非常舒适。
巨头想要“围剿”英伟达CUDA?恐怕没那么容易……
1、巨头想要“围剿”英伟达CUDA?恐怕没那么容易 2022年11月底,ChatGPT的出现不仅点燃了生成式AI的浪潮,同时也将GPU巨头英伟达送上了神坛。如今的英伟达靠着AI芯片的领先,不仅在市值上一路飞涨,同时垄断了全球AI算力近90%的市场。然而,这一垄断地位正面临着来自各方的挑战。
cuda,cudnn,conda,anaconda的区别与联系
1、CUDA是操纵GPU进行并行计算的工具,而Anaconda是操作Python环境的工具。在深度学习中,代码通常通过Python实现,而Python需要与CUDA通信以调用GPU完成计算。
2、conda是一个开源软件包管理系统,支持Windows、MACOS和LINUX等多个操作系统,适用于多种编程语言(包括Python、R、Ruby、Lua、scala、JAVA、JavaScript、C/C++、FORTRAN等)。它不仅用于安装、运行和更新软件包及其依赖项,还适用于多种编程语言。
3、Anaconda与Conda:Anaconda是一个包含conda和其他软件包的发行版,而Conda是一个独立的包和环境管理工具。Pip与Conda:Pip是Python官方的包管理工具,适用于在已有的Python环境中安装Python包;而Conda是一个更通用的包和环境管理工具,适用于多种语言和复杂的依赖关系。
GPU编程3:CUDA环境安装和IDE配置
1、在Clion中新建CUDA项目。配置CMake以代替makefile,简化编译过程。根据需要设置CMakeLists.txt文件,以正确配置CUDA编译选项。通过以上步骤,你可以在个人机器上成功安装CUDA环境,并配置Clion进行CUDA编程。
2、要让你的Python在GPU上运行,需要按照以下步骤正确安装和配置CUDA及相关环境: 确定版本兼容性 了解GPU驱动支持的CUDA版本:首先,确认你的电脑GPU显卡驱动支持的CUDA版本。 查找Python及相关库的适配版本:根据已确定的CUDA版本,查找与之兼容的Python版本以及TensorFlow、PyTorch等深度学习框架的版本。
3、按照安装向导的提示进行安装。安装完成后,打开Anaconda Prompt(或Anaconda Navigator),创建一个新的Python环境用于机器学习、深度学习。配置IDE Anaconda默认配置了一些IDE,如Spyder。你也可以根据自己的喜好选择其他IDE,如PyCharm或VScode。
4、首先,确保Python、TensorFlow、Keras、PyTorch、CUDA和CuDnn之间的版本匹配。了解电脑GPU显卡驱动及可支持的CUDA版本,查找Python版本及对应库的适配版本,最终确定CUDA和CuDnn版本。下载CUDA和CuDnn时,请关注版本匹配,访问官方开发者页面获取相应链接。
5、验证安装:打开命令行或IDE,运行以下测试脚本,检查torch GPU环境是否配置成功:pythonimport torchprint) 如果返回True,说明环境设置成功。通过以上步骤,你应该能够在windows 11上成功配置torch GPU环境,针对CUDA 16或13版本。如果遇到任何问题,可以查阅PyTorch官网的文档或寻求社区帮助。
6、如果遇到下载问题,这里有备用的安装包可供下载:[链接] pan.baidu.com/s/18clIQk...,提取码:0919。最后,确认安装是否成功,打开命令行或IDE,运行以下测试脚本,如果返回True,说明环境设置成功:通过以上步骤,你就可以顺利地配置好torch GPU环境。在安装过程中遇到任何困难,随时可以私信寻求帮助。
GPU编程常识求助:cg、opencv、opengl、cuda、glsl等
首先,cg,opengl,glsl都是跟计算机图形有关的。cg基本是做渲染的,opengl是一个开源图形库,和微软的direct3D是一样的。glsl是SHAding language ,专门用来写Shader的,在GPGPU( general purpose GPU)概念出来之前,好多人用glsl来做并行计算。
OpenCV中卷积的实现方式主要包括以下几种:CUDA:利用NVIDIA的CUDA库,直接在GPU上进行卷积运算。这种方式能够充分利用GPU的并行计算能力,提高卷积运算的速度。OpenCL:OpenCL是一个用于异构平台的开源框架,支持多种处理器和硬件加速器。
本文来自作者[金生]投稿,不代表域帮网立场,如若转载,请注明出处:http://m.yubangwang.com/27614.html
评论列表(4条)
我是域帮网的签约作者“金生”!
希望本篇文章《微软gpu开源编程? 微软开源软件?》能对你有所帮助!
本站[域帮网]内容主要涵盖:鱼泽号
本文概览:主流AI框架,总有一款适合你1、推荐:modelArts、PAI、Paddle等解决方案,从宏观层面了解AI。AI从业者但不追求模型部...